Toddler

Can't You Sleep, Little Bear?

Martin Waddell
Illustrated by Barbara Firth

  • This special book is about fear of the dark
  • The pictures and words work together perfectly
  • Look for more great Little Bear books

 

Publisher: Walker Books

About the author

Martin Waddell

I was read to a lot as a child by people who knew how to read stories. These stories came alive for me, and the love of story has stayed with me ever since. Barbara Firth

When she was three, Barabra began drawing plants and animals, and when she was eleven years old, her family moved to the country, enabling her to spend even more time sketching the flora and fauna around her.
